BACKEND/NestJS2 NestJS 설치 Node.js를 설치하면 Node.js에서 사용하는 패키지를 관리하는 npm(Node Package Manager)도 설치합니다. 즉, npm은 https://www.npmjs.com에 등록된 라이브러리들을 쉽게 설치, 삭제할 수 있게 해줍니다.NestJS 설치NestJS는 Node.js를 기반으로 하기 때문에 먼저 Node.js를 설치합니다.최신 버전은 https://nodejs.org/download 페이지에서 다운로드 후 설치합니다. 설치 방법은 공식 사이트를 참고하세요.NestJS 설치는 npm을 통해 필요한 라이브러리들을 하나씩 설치하거나 간편하게 프로젝트를 생성할 수 있는 nest-cli 패키지로 설치하는 방법 그리고 git clone으로 작업 디렉토리에 내려받은 후 설정을 변경하는 방법 등이.. 2024. 12. 28. NestJS 알아보기 NestJS는 Node.js의 유연함을 그대로 가지면서도 프레임워크 내에 유용한 기술을 이미 다수 구현해 두었습니다.NestJS는 Node.js에 기반을 둔 웹 API 프레임워크로 Express 혹은 fastify 프레임워크를 래핑하여 동작합니다. 아시다시피 Express와 fastify는 모두 Node.js를 쉽게 사용하기 위해 만들어진 프레임워크입니다. 즉, NestJS로 작성한 소스 코드를 Node.js 기반 프레임워크인 Express나 fastify에서 실행 가능한 자바스크립트 소스 코드로 컴파일하는 역할을 합니다.NestJS는 기본 설치 시 Express를 설치합니다. fastify와 같은 다른 프레임워크 대신에 Express를 사용하는 이유는 Express가 가장 널리 사용되고 있고 수많은 미.. 2023. 11. 25. 이전 1 다음